Biography

Nadine De Moras specializes in French Studies, focusing on applied linguistics and phonetics, particularly in the acquisition and teaching of native and second languages. She has made significant contributions to the field through her research on teaching pronunciation in second language acquisition and language manual design based on linguistic research. Nadine's work emphasizes the importance of frequency in language learning, addressing both grammatical gender and final consonants in French. Additionally, she has engaged in various publications, including her recent articles in the Online Journal ACPI and contributions to conference proceedings. With a strong academic background, she earned her PhD and MA from Western University and a BA from Paul Valéry University in France. Her commitment to language pedagogy is evident in her ongoing research and publications, where she explores innovative methods for teaching French as a second language and developing literacy in primary education.
